Multi-Party calls

Making a Multi-Party Call

A multi-party call is a network service that allows up to six
people to participate in a multi-party or conference call.

For further details about subscribing to this service, contact
T-Mobile customer service.

Setting up a Multi-Party Call

1.

From the Home screen, tap

.

2.

Dial the number for the first participant and tap

.

3.

Tap Add call, enter the second phone number and

tap

. The first caller is placed on hold.

4.

Wait for the second caller to answer the incoming call and

tap Join. The two calls are now joined into a multi-party

call and display in the order in which they were called.

Important!: A maximum of two callers can be joined to a single multi-party

line. Additional callers participate in a new Multiparty session
and are held in conjunction with the previous multiparty call. You
can swap or place each multi-party call on hold.
